Lagerstroemia indica 'Rubra' (red crapemyrtle) bears showy, bright red and repeat-blooming blooms during mid-summer to early fall. This tree is rounded in form and has medium green foliage that is glossy and medium textured. The bark is showy, multi-coloured and spotted and exfoliating in texture. Find a prominent place in your garden for this stunning tree which has been designated a specimen.
Typical Uses
Border, foundation, shade, specimen, street planting and screening.
Special Characteristics
Birds are attracted to Lagerstroemia indica 'Rubra' . Lagerstroemia indica 'Rubra' is tolerant of drought, compacted soil and pollution.
Cautions
When planning your garden, take into consideration that Lagerstroemia indica 'Rubra' (red crapemyrtle) grows at a fast rate and will fill its designated space quickly.
